Goals a plenty last Saturday as East Budleigh Reserves won a thriller by the odd goal in nine at Sidmouth.
The hosts took the lead before Ross Bright scored with a close-range volley. Sidmouth regained the advantage only for Ben Wilks to snatch an equaliser as the home side failed to clear a long throw.
Player of the match for Budleigh was ‘keeper Chris Wardle who made a couple of excellent saves, but he was unable to prevent the home side leading 3-2 at the break.
In a feisty second half Dan Atkinson dispatched a penalty to level the scores, but once again Sidmouth went in front.
Nathan Penhallurick was next to strike for Budleigh with a well-placed cross-shot and in a nail-biting finish Atkinson kept his cool to score his second penalty and give the Jays victory.
The First X1 had a day to forget in Division 1, beaten 8-1 by Wellington.
